Core Advantages of Apia Lithium Battery Packs

Unlike traditional lead-acid batteries, the Apia series offers:

  • 98% Depth of Discharge (DoD) – Maximizes usable capacity
  • 5,000+ cycle life at 80% capacity retention
  • Modular design for 5kWh to 100MWh configurations
  • -20°C to 60°C operational range
"Lithium-ion storage costs have dropped 89% since 2010, making solutions like Apia batteries commercially viable." – BloombergNEF 2023 Report

Performance Comparison Table

MetricApia LithiumLead-Acid
Energy Density200 Wh/kg30-50 Wh/kg
Cycle Life5,000+300-500
Charge Efficiency99%70-85%

Top 3 Application Scenarios

1. Renewable Energy Integration

Solar farms in Arizona using Apia batteries achieved 92% curtailment reduction. Their rapid response time (0.8ms) helps stabilize grids when clouds affect PV output.

2. Commercial Backup Power

A Singapore data center avoided $2.1M in downtime costs during grid outages using Apia's 10-second failover capability.

3. EV Charging Stations

Apia's 350kW peak discharge rate enables ultra-fast EV charging without grid upgrades. A pilot project in Germany charges 50 vehicles/day using existing infrastructure.

Market Outlook: Lithium Battery Storage

The global market will grow at 18.5% CAGR through 2030 (Grand View Research). Key drivers include:

  • Falling renewable energy costs
  • EV infrastructure expansion
  • Grid modernization initiatives
